Gutter Cleaning in Westchester County, NY
Gutter cleaning services involve the removal of leaves, debris, and buildup from the gutters and downspouts of a property. This process helps ensure proper water flow away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and landscape erosion. Projects typically include clearing out blockages, flushing the gutters to check for proper drainage, and inspecting for any damage or leaks that may require repairs. Homeowners often request this service to maintain the integrity of their roofing system and to avoid issues caused by clogged gutters, especially during seasons with heavy rainfall or falling leaves.
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ners should consider the height and accessibility of their gutters, as well as any specific concerns about pest nests or damage. It is also helpful to understand whether the service includes a thorough inspection and flushing of the entire gutter system.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and that any necessary repairs or maintenance are addressed alongside cleaning. Properly maintained gutters contribute to the overall health of a property and help prevent costly repairs in the future.

Common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Gutter Cleaning - Removal of leaves, debris, and obstructions to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ter Inspection - Checking for damage, leaks, or sagging that could affect gutter performance.
Gutter Flushing - Rinsing out gutters to clear out stubborn dirt and prevent clogs.
Downspout Clearing - Ensuring downspouts are free of blockages to direct water away from the foundation.
Gutter Maintenance - Regular upkeep to prevent water damage and extend gutter lifespan.
Gutter Repair - Fixing leaks, holes, or loose brackets to maintain gutter integrity.
Gutter Cleaning Questions
Why is gutter cleaning important?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and pest infestations by ensuring proper drainage away from the property.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utter cleaning is typically recommended at least twice a year, especially after heavy storms or during peak leaf fall seasons.
What types of debris are removed during cleaning?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, dirt, and other blockages that can cause clogs and water overflow.
Can gutter cleaning prevent roof damage? Yes, keeping gutters clear helps prevent water from backing up onto the roof, reducing the risk of leaks and damage.
